Baby French Toast Sticks

Description

A fun and healthy breakfast option for toddlers, these Baby French Toast Sticks are easy to make and perfect for little hands.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 slices of whole grain bread
  • 1 egg
  • 1/4 cup of milk
  • 1/4 teaspoon of vanilla extract
  • 1/4 teaspoon of cinnamon (optional)
  • A pinch of salt
  • Olive oil or butter for cooking

Instructions

  1. Cut the slices of bread into strips, about 1-inch wide.
  2. Whisk together the egg, milk,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and salt until smooth in a bowl.
  3. Heat a skillet on medium heat and add a little olive oil or butter.
  4. Dip each bread strip into the egg mixture, making sure both sides are coated.
  5. Place the coated strips in the skillet and cook for 2-3 minutes on each side until golden brown.
  6. Remove them from the skillet and let cool slightly before serving.

Notes

Serve warm with fresh fruit, yogurt, or a drizzle of maple syrup.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for 2-3 days or freeze for up to a month.
